We are seeking a highly motivated, creative, and rigorous Senior Scientist I/II to join our Neuroscience Discovery team, as part of the Movement Disorders pillar. The successful candidate will play a key role in identifying, evaluating, and characterizing novel biologic-based bispecific molecules using human induced pluripotent stem cell (iPSC)-derived dopaminergic neurons and mouse primary neuronal cultures. This role requires strong experimental design, hands-on cell culture experience, and a collaborative spirit to enable high-quality data generation and decision making in support of AbbVie’s strategic neuroscience portfolio.
Qualifications
- Bachelor’s Degree or equivalent education and typically 12 years of experience, Master’s Degree or equivalent education and typically 10 years of experience, PhD and typically 4 years of experience.
- Demonstrated expertise in human iPSC-derived neuronal culture; experience with dopaminergic neuron models strongly preferred.
- Proficiency in mouse/rodent primary neuron culture and molecular or imaging-based assays (e.g., calcium imaging, immunocytochemistry, high-content screening).
- Experience with mouse in vivo systems is a plus
- Experience working with protein or antibody-based modulators and understanding biologics mechanisms of action is a plus.
